About 1-[[(3S)-2-methyl-3,4-dihydro-1H-isoquinolin-3-yl]methyl]-3-(2-methyl-1-phenylpropan-2-yl)urea
1-[[(3S)-2-methyl-3,4-dihydro-1H-isoquinolin-3-yl]methyl]-3-(2-methyl-1-phenylpropan-2-yl)urea (PubChem CID 135214421) has the molecular formula C22H29N3O
and a molecular weight of 351.49 g/mol. Its IUPAC name is 1-[[(3S)-2-methyl-3,4-dihydro-1H-isoquinolin-3-yl]methyl]-3-(2-methyl-1-phenylpropan-2-yl)urea.
